Key Features That Set Apex Watches Apart
Apex watches have carved out their own niche in the smart watch world. They stand out for their focus on professional use. Apex watches offer features tailored for business and productivity. Some key features include:
- Advanced calendar integration
- Email and message notifications
- Voice-to-text capabilities
- Customizable watch faces for different work environments
Apex also emphasizes long battery life. This is crucial for busy professionals. Their watches often last several days on a single charge. Apex's attention to detail in design is another standout feature. They offer sleek, sophisticated looks that fit well in office settings. These features have made Apex a go-to choice for many working professionals.

Daily Use and Battery Life: Comparing Customer Experiences
When it comes to daily use, both FILA and Apex have their strengths. FILA watches are praised for their comfort during all-day wear. Users find them lightweight and suitable for various activities. Apex watches get high marks for their seamless integration into daily routines. Their professional features make them valuable tools throughout the workday. Battery life is a crucial factor in daily use. Apex generally has the edge here, with many models lasting 3-5 days. FILA watches typically need charging every 1-2 days, depending on usage. However, FILA's faster charging times help balance this out. User experiences vary, but both brands receive positive feedback for reliability in daily use.
